They just gonna tell you wrong page. Get a cord grip for it and re land everything. Did you find the screw that held the white wire down? When it came loose the neutral (white wire) shorted out to the hot on the left. It probably tripped the breaker. First verify the breaker is off and it is unplugged then redo the cord with a cord grip. Then post an after pic to r/askelectricians and see if it's all good.
